| Abstract | Deploying interactive applications in the cloud is a challenge due to the high variability in performance of cloud services. In this paper, we present Dealer - a system that helps geo-distributed, interactive and multi-tier applications meet their stringent requirements on response time despite such variability. Our approach is motivated by the fact that, at any time, only a small number of application components of large multi-tier applications experience poor performance. Dealer continually monitors the performance of individual components and communication latencies between them to build a global view of the application. In serving any given request, Dealer seeks to minimize user response times by picking the best combination of replicas (potentially located across different data centers). While Dealer requires modifications to application code, we show the changes required are modest. Our evaluations on two multi-tier applications using real cloud deployments indicate the 90%ile of response times could be reduced by more than a factor of 6 under natural cloud dynamics. Our results indicate the cost of inter-data-center traffic with Dealer is minor, and that Dealer can in fact be used to reduce the overall operational costs of applications by up to 15% by leveraging the difference in billing plans of cloud instances. |
